ZAS

Region : Galicia
Province : A Coruña

Escudo de Zas

Official blazon

De gules, torre donjonada de oro aclarada de azur con dos perros de plata acollarados de azur pasantes al pie. Bordura de plata ocho mazorcas de maiz hojadas de sinople.
